Common Foundation Moisture Control Jobs
Foundation moisture control - helps prevent water intrusion and reduces the risk of foundation damage.
Drainage improvements - directs excess water away from the foundation to minimize moisture buildup.
Waterproofing solutions - seals foundation walls to keep moisture out and protect the structure.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to maintain a dry basement or crawl space.
Moisture barrier installation - prevents ground moisture from seeping into the foundation area.
Soil grading services - ensures proper slope around the property to divert water away from the foundation.
Foundation Moisture Control Questions
What is foundation moisture control? It involves managing moisture levels around a building's foundation to prevent issues like cracking, shifting, or water intrusion.
Why is moisture control important for foundations? Proper moisture levels help maintain the stability of the foundation and protect the property from water-related damage.
What types of foundation moisture control services are available? Services include installing vapor barriers, drainage systems, and moisture barriers to keep foundation areas dry.
How can property owners identify moisture problems in the foundation? Signs include mold growth, musty odors, cracks, or uneven flooring near the foundation area.
